BROWNSDALE CO-OP. ASS'N v. HOME INS. CO.

No. C7-91-220.

473 N.W.2d 339 (1991)

BROWNSDALE COOPERATIVE ASSOCIATION, Respondent, v. HOME INSURANCE COMPANY,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Minnesota.

Review Denied September 25, 1991.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Bryan J. Baudler, Baudler, Baudler, Maus & Blahnik, Austin, for respondent.

Seth M. Colton, John D. Norquist, Maun & Simon, Saint Paul, for appellant.

Considered and decided by KLAPHAKE, P.J., and LANSING and DAVIES, JJ.


OPINION

LANSING, Judge.

In an appeal from a declaratory judgment action enforcing a Miller-Shugart-type settlement, Home Insurance Company contests the trial court's finding of policy coverage and, based on lack of notice, challenges the enforceability of the settlement agreement. We conclude that the record supports the finding of coverage and hold that because Home breached its duty to defend its insured, it was not entitled to notice of the settlement...
